straps joined together that go around an animal such as a horse, allowing a person to direct its movement or pull a cart, or similar bands worn by a person for protection
Rafael fastened the horse's harness before the morning ride.
Rafael 在晨騎前繫好了馬的馬具。
The rock climber checked every strap on her safety harness before starting the climb.
攀岩者在開始攀登前檢查了安全背帶上的每一條帶子。

to take control of something such as a natural force or personal ability and use it in a productive way
The new dam harnesses the power of the river to generate electricity.
新水壩利用河流的水力來發電。
collocation: harness + the power of
Scientists are trying to harness solar energy more efficiently.
科學家正嘗試更有效率地利用太陽能。
collocation: harness solar energy
The company hopes to harness the creativity of its young designers.
那家公司希望能發揮年輕設計師的創造力。
Ayesha believes we can harness wind power to use less coal and oil.
Ayesha 相信我們可以運用風力來減少煤和石油的使用。
collocation: harness wind power
Jessica learned to harness her anger and use it as motivation.
Jessica 學會了控制自己的怒氣,並把它化為動力。

harness + noun phrase (energy source / ability / force)
用法筆記
Common objects include natural forces (sun, wind, water), energy sources, and abstract qualities (talent, creativity, passion). Cannot be used for ordinary machines or tools.
